Huntnfmly,
You and your girls are going to have a great time with OVGS. Jerrod is a great guy and will put you on deer. I went with him last year for my late whitetail hunt. I was very impressed with how much work he put in on my stand, scouting, and all around making sure it would be a good experience. Now, I didn't get to enjoy much of it due to him putting me on the buck I wanted about 15 minutes into the hunt (a nice 7x6 whitey) but it was still exciting.
He has a bunch of guys that guide for him as well. All of them that I have met are great guys that really know their stuff. They scout hard so that when the hunt comes, you will be in the right place at the right time! Jerrod also isn't someone that will build you up on BS.....he is a straight shooter. I know I was going to buy my son a trip with him this year for rifle season, but he was booked solid. I do know that most of his clients are returns, so he must be doing something right.
